Modern applications live and die by the quality of their search experience. Whether you are building an ecommerce store, SaaS platform, knowledge base, or internal tool, users expect instant, relevant, and typo-tolerant results. While hosted solutions are popular, many organizations choose self-hosted search engines for better data control, privacy, and cost predictability. Meilisearch has become a well-known option in this space, but it is far from the only one. There are several powerful alternatives worth evaluating depending on your technical requirements and infrastructure strategy.

TL;DR: If you are looking for apps like Meilisearch for self-hosted search, strong alternatives include Elasticsearch, OpenSearch, Typesense, Apache Solr, and ZincSearch. Each solution differs in complexity, scalability, resource usage, and ecosystem support. Meilisearch excels in simplicity and developer experience, while tools like Elasticsearch and OpenSearch offer deeper enterprise-grade capabilities. Your choice should depend on your need for scalability, relevance tuning, analytics, and operational control.

Why Consider Alternatives to Meilisearch?

Meilisearch is widely appreciated for its ease of use, fast indexing, typo tolerance, and developer-friendly API. However, different use cases may push teams to explore other options. Common reasons include:

  • Advanced analytics and aggregations requirements
  • Need for large-scale, distributed infrastructure
  • Compliance or security policies requiring specific tooling
  • Performance tuning beyond Meilisearch’s default capabilities
  • Desire for a broader plugin ecosystem

Self-hosted search engines vary significantly in architecture. Some prioritize simplicity and speed, while others are designed for massive distributed systems processing billions of records.

1. Elasticsearch

Elasticsearch is arguably the most recognized search engine platform in the world. Built on Apache Lucene, it offers distributed search and analytics capabilities at massive scale.

Best for: Enterprise applications, log analytics, and large distributed systems.

Key Strengths

  • Horizontally scalable distributed architecture
  • Advanced query DSL for fine-grained relevance tuning
  • Powerful aggregations and analytics
  • Mature ecosystem with Kibana and Beats

Considerations

  • Steeper learning curve compared to Meilisearch
  • Higher resource consumption
  • More complex DevOps management

Elasticsearch is not as lightweight as Meilisearch, but it provides unparalleled flexibility. If your search layer must support analytics dashboards, logging pipelines, or large-scale ecommerce filtering, Elasticsearch is often the default choice.

2. OpenSearch

OpenSearch began as a fork of Elasticsearch and Kibana. It is completely open-source and maintained by a broad community.

Best for: Teams seeking Elasticsearch-like functionality with full open-source governance.

Key Strengths

  • Elasticsearch-compatible APIs
  • Active open-source community
  • Advanced security and plugin support
  • Built-in observability tools

For organizations wary of licensing changes or seeking long-term open-source guarantees, OpenSearch delivers a compelling alternative. Operational complexity remains similar to Elasticsearch, but the ecosystem continues to mature rapidly.

3. Typesense

Typesense is often mentioned alongside Meilisearch for its simplicity and speed. It is designed to be easy to deploy and developer-friendly while providing strong search relevance out of the box.

Best for: Startups, SaaS products, and teams wanting a simple but powerful API-driven search engine.

Key Strengths

  • Simple RESTful API
  • Low configuration overhead
  • Built-in typo tolerance
  • Lightweight clustering support

Considerations

  • Smaller ecosystem compared to Elasticsearch
  • Less extensive analytics tooling

Compared to Meilisearch, Typesense offers similar user-friendliness but sometimes provides more explicit control over ranking and filtering behavior. For teams seeking a balance between power and simplicity, Typesense is a serious contender.

4. Apache Solr

Apache Solr is one of the oldest open-source search platforms and also built on Apache Lucene. It has been battle-tested in enterprise environments for years.

Best for: Mature enterprises and organizations requiring robust customization.

Key Strengths

  • Highly configurable indexing and querying
  • Strong community support
  • Advanced replication and clustering
  • Fine-grained relevance tuning

Considerations

  • Complex configuration
  • Less modern developer experience

While Solr may not feel as streamlined as Meilisearch, it offers exceptional control. Organizations with in-house search expertise may prefer Solr’s detailed configuration model.

5. ZincSearch

ZincSearch is a lightweight and modern alternative designed to simplify full-text indexing and log search.

Best for: Developers seeking a minimal and easy-to-deploy search engine.

Key Strengths

  • Single binary deployment
  • Elasticsearch-compatible API
  • Lower system resource requirements

ZincSearch does not yet match the feature richness of Elasticsearch or OpenSearch, but it offers simplicity comparable to Meilisearch, especially for smaller-scale projects.

Comparison Chart

Tool Ease of Use Scalability Analytics Capabilities Best For
Meilisearch Very High Moderate Basic Fast product search, developer-friendly apps
Elasticsearch Moderate Very High Advanced Enterprise search and analytics
OpenSearch Moderate Very High Advanced Open-source enterprise environments
Typesense High Moderate Limited to Moderate SaaS and startup applications
Apache Solr Low to Moderate High Advanced Highly customized enterprise search
ZincSearch High Moderate Basic Lightweight deployments

Choosing the Right Self-Hosted Search Engine

When evaluating alternatives to Meilisearch, consider the following factors:

1. Scalability Requirements

If you anticipate millions of documents and complex filtering, distributed systems like Elasticsearch or OpenSearch are strong candidates. Smaller datasets may run efficiently on Meilisearch or Typesense with fewer infrastructure demands.

2. Relevance and Query Flexibility

Meilisearch is optimized for excellent default relevance. However, if you need custom scoring scripts, advanced aggregations, or detailed ranking adjustments, Elasticsearch and Solr provide greater depth.

3. Infrastructure Complexity

Operational simplicity matters. Teams without dedicated DevOps resources may prefer tools that run as a single binary with minimal configuration.

4. Ecosystem and Integrations

Elasticsearch and OpenSearch integrate seamlessly with data pipelines, logging systems, and observability stacks. Meilisearch and Typesense focus more on application-level search use cases.

Security and Compliance Considerations

Self-hosting search engines provides greater control over data governance, security policies, and compliance requirements. However, it also places responsibility on your team. Enterprise-focused engines often provide:

  • Role-based access control
  • Audit logging
  • Encryption at rest and in transit
  • Fine-grained index-level permissions

If you operate in regulated environments such as healthcare or finance, evaluate these capabilities carefully before choosing a platform.

Final Thoughts

Meilisearch has earned its reputation as a modern, approachable search engine that delivers exceptional performance with minimal setup. However, alternatives like Elasticsearch, OpenSearch, Typesense, Apache Solr, and ZincSearch each bring distinct advantages.

For startups and product-focused teams, Typesense and Meilisearch often provide the best blend of simplicity and speed.

For large-scale, enterprise-grade deployments, Elasticsearch and OpenSearch remain dominant due to their scalability and analytics depth.

For organizations requiring deep customization, Apache Solr remains a reliable, if more complex, option.

Ultimately, the right solution depends on your technical capacity, expected data growth, and strategic priorities. Careful testing with real-world datasets—rather than relying solely on documentation—will provide the most accurate insight. In search infrastructure, performance, relevance quality, and operational stability are far more important than popularity alone.

Scroll to Top
Scroll to Top